First of all, I want to draw your attention to the fact that this the pan does not have a non-stick coating , so frying on it without oil does not make sense. But it is necessary to warm it up well - it is good that, apparently, due to the three-layer structure (a layer of aluminum between two layers of stainless steel) it does not take much time. Warmed up, greased with vegetable oil and then we begin to cook with a subsequent decrease in temperature.


Separately, it should be said about the dimensions of the pan. The site says diameter 28 cm (there is also 24 cm), and height - 6 cm ... Note that the diameter is given at the top, while the bottom has a smaller diameter - about 21 cm ... This is worth paying attention to if you are choosing a pan for use on a glass-ceramic hob, when it is important that the diameter of the bottom of the pan and the burner match. In general, this pan is positioned as suitable for all types of stoves.

If the size can be considered optimal, then the weight presents some problem - it is not very convenient to use an almost two-kilogram frying pan. I did not weigh her, but at least the Ikea website states that her weight - 1.9 kg ... Therefore, I advise you to think before buying whether you are ready to "pump up your muscles" with this frying pan. In the end, if you do not calculate the force, then you can accidentally damage that very glass-ceramic surface ...


Otherwise, I did not notice any serious shortcomings or features. The handle is quite comfortable and has a silicone rubber insert on the bottom.

By the way, I had to buy the lid in Ashan - I didn't like the Ikeevskaya HOLIG at all, because it sat in the pan somehow unevenly, as if it did not fit in diameter. In addition, its design does not provide for a steam outlet.

Bottom line: As a non-stick skillet, it's not a bad option. Food sometimes does burn, but not fatally. For me, the main disadvantage is still its weight.

Advantages and disadvantages

  • First of all, it is the appearance. The shine of stainless steel will decorate any kitchen.
  • Low weight will delight female chefs. Even in models with a thickened bottom, the massiveness inherent in cast iron is not observed.
  • Overheating, burning food or mechanical damage does not affect the quality of the material in any way. Steel does not emit toxic or harmful substances. It also does not change the taste or smell of food.
  • The main purpose of the frying pan is to be used in conjunction with, which requires steel dishes for the magnetic effect. But this fact does not interfere with heating the pan on any heating equipment (only a microwave oven will not work).
  • Steel does not rust and does not undergo oxidation, which distinguishes this material favorably from aluminum.

All the disadvantages of stainless steel are reduced only to the loss of the appearance of the pan:

  • Greenish or bluish spots appear on the bottom if the cookware is heated when empty. The quality of the steel does not change, it is just a visual defect. Stains can be easily removed if desired.
  • The situation is more complicated with oil burnt on the outside of the pan. It is difficult to wash it off.
    Stainless steel is afraid of abrasive detergents. If you clean the pan with the use of powders, you can lose its aesthetic appearance - ugly scratches will appear on the polished surface and it will fade.

Care rules

Stainless steel is a special alloy of nickel and chromium that does not oxidize. In a frying pan from this material, you can cook any dishes, including spicy or sour ones.

Stainless steel is sensitive to salt. Do not add salt to the bottom of the pan.

Heat stains can be removed with a cloth soaked in vinegar or lemon juice.

You cannot wash the dishes in a heated state.

For cleaning, do not use metal graters and detergents with abrasive particles.

For washing, use warm water and a soft sponge. It is permissible to use liquid detergents that do not contain ammonia or chlorine.

Stubborn dirt can be removed with the dishwasher (also use the soak mode).

A clean frying pan should be wiped dry with a towel.
